It doesn't necessarily make sense that the inventor you mentioned must be the applicant. There are fewer and fewer heroes who fight alone now. Many inventions and patents applied for by core technologies are the wisdom and contributions of many people in large companies. Do you think the technological achievements (patents) that the company paid a lot of money for should belong to the inventors?
In fact, the inventor only made use of the company's equipment and resources and contributed his own strength, and could not hold the patent right. This is the concept of service invention.
